diff options
author | Thierry Vignaud <tv@mandriva.org> | 2010-01-05 12:45:37 +0000 |
---|---|---|
committer | Thierry Vignaud <tv@mandriva.org> | 2010-01-05 12:45:37 +0000 |
commit | ddfb5d2b8d3a7005bfabf301188fecd51a721101 (patch) | |
tree | 8358c37a65151bbb5db27c6cbdad5f2f60dc21ba | |
parent | b8a49716bdfc7d60b393b305189df0a82b87e4d8 (diff) | |
download | urpmi-ddfb5d2b8d3a7005bfabf301188fecd51a721101.tar urpmi-ddfb5d2b8d3a7005bfabf301188fecd51a721101.tar.gz urpmi-ddfb5d2b8d3a7005bfabf301188fecd51a721101.tar.bz2 urpmi-ddfb5d2b8d3a7005bfabf301188fecd51a721101.tar.xz urpmi-ddfb5d2b8d3a7005bfabf301188fecd51a721101.zip |
rename @requested_kernels as @latest_kernels as its purpopse really is to
track latest kernels for every flavor, not kernel packages that are required
by 3rd party packages
-rw-r--r-- | urpm/orphans.pm |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/urpm/orphans.pm b/urpm/orphans.pm index 5aef3c6d..8ad304fc 100644 --- a/urpm/orphans.pm +++ b/urpm/orphans.pm @@ -312,7 +312,7 @@ sub _get_current_kernel_package() { # do not care about (eg: kernel-devel, kernel-firmware, kernel-latest) # so it's useless to look at them # -my (@requested_kernels, %kernels); +my (@latest_kernels, %kernels); sub _kernel_callback { my ($pkg, $unreq_list) = @_; my $shortname = $pkg->name; @@ -329,7 +329,7 @@ sub _kernel_callback { # keep track of latest kernels in order not to try removing requested kernels: if ($n =~ /latest/) { - push @requested_kernels, $pkg->requires; + push @latest_kernels, $pkg->requires; } else { $kernels{$shortname} = $pkg; } @@ -339,7 +339,7 @@ sub _kernel_callback { # - returns list of orphan kernels sub _get_orphan_kernels() { # keep kernels required by kernel-*-latest: - delete $kernels{$_} foreach @requested_kernels; + delete $kernels{$_} foreach @latest_kernels; # return list of unused/orphan kernels: %kernels; } |